Ernie appears to share many of the same capabilities as OpenAI's ChatGPT, but investors were left disappointed after its grand unveiling was limited to recorded videos rather than any live demonstrations.
But the demonstration failed to move investors, as everything was shown in pre-recorded videos rather than live.Hundreds of companies have signed up to use the tech, however, which Baidu says could be used to power smart devices and driverless cars.
Shares tumbled as much as 10% during the presentation. While they had recovered slightly by the end, it still shaved $3bn off the company's market valuation. Analyst Kai Wang said:"It seems like the presentation was more of a monologue and scripted, rather than an interactive session that people were looking for.Please use Chrome browser for a more accessible video playerBaidu boss Mr Li appeared to compliment OpenAI's tech during his presentation, saying it showed the threshold was high for companies looking to succeed in the space.
His speech was live-streamed across a number of platforms, including some that are blocked in China itself, like YouTube and Twitter.The presentation came days after OpenAI announced the, which has attracted hundreds of millions of users since launching in late 2022. Microsoft is also hosting an AI event on Thursday, while Google this week said it would be bringing generative AI to workplace apps like Gmail and Docs.
